As of August 2026, Jacksonville is neither a hot seller's market nor a distressed one. It's a moderately balanced market where well-priced, move-in-ready homes still go under contract within one to two months and close within a few percent of asking price. Sellers who price strategically and prepare their homes can still get strong results, but the days of automatic above-list bidding wars are behind us for now.
